About 306 Ecton Pl
Open 4 Bed, 2.5 bath open concept floor plan, main level offers formal dining, office, large kitchen with optional island open to the great room. Second level features owners suite with two walk-in closets, optional trey ceilings and garden tub with separate walk-in shower. Living in Greenville, SC
Greenville's transport infrastructure supports both private and public transit options, with a network of roads and highways that facilitate commuting and travel within the city and to neighboring areas. Public transportation services are available, providing connectivity across different parts of the city. The community is also attentive to the needs of pedestrians and cyclists, with areas that are particularly friendly to walking and biking. Ongoing initiatives aim to enhance transport efficiency and accessibility, ensuring that residents and visitors can navigate the city with ease.
The community benefits from a comprehensive educational system, with a number of public and private schools that cater to various educational needs, from elementary to high school levels. Greenville also boasts several higher education institutions, contributing to the city's focus on learning and development. Healthcare services are well-represented, with major hospitals and clinics providing a range of medical care. The city's public library system supports lifelong learning, while the retail and dining landscape reflects the local culture, offering everything from boutique shops to diverse culinary experiences.
Greenville is celebrated for its vibrant downtown and the scenic beauty of its surrounding areas. The community prides itself on a rich cultural scene, with numerous local events and festivals that highlight the city's artistic and historical heritage. The character of Greenville is defined by its blend of urban amenities and charming green spaces, creating an environment that appeals to both city dwellers and nature enthusiasts alike.
Greenville, South Carolina, offers a diverse housing market with a blend of architectural styles that cater to a range of preferences. The housing landscape is predominantly composed of single-family homes, which feature prominently in the city's residential areas. These homes vary in design, showcasing modern, traditional, and craftsman influences. Apartments and townhouses are also available, providing options for those seeking a more urban living experience. The homeownership rate in Greenville is robust, reflecting a community invested in long-term residency and stability.

While more than 48 listings in Greenville, SC in June 2025 were sold above asking price, there were more than 56 listings sold at asking price, and more than 133 were sold below. The inventory of homes for sale in Greenville, SC between May and June 2025 increased by 6.1%. The median list price of listings available in June 2025 was $365,964, while the average time on the real estate market was 18 days.
